The Colonial shape was introduced around 1900. It was one of Homer Laughlin's most extensive lines of dinnerware with over 100 pieces.

Many retailers carried Colonial. Montgomery Ward's carried the shape with decals and in plain, undecorated white. Sears offered HLC's Colonial shape with decals for several years. One of Sears' advertisements gave this description of the line:

The decoration consists of neat floral spays of dainty azalias, so delicately shaded and so applied by the new decalcomania process, which produces a much more perfect decoration than if double glaze, and a decoration of this sort will wear a lifetime and never fade, and is a much stronger ware an account of the extra length of time required in the firing. This set is made of a very find quality semi-porcelain, made by the famous Homer Laughlin China Co., America's best potters, and is fully guaranteed in every respect. The shape used in the set is known as the new Colonial pattern, which is the most artistic shape made. The ware is exceedingly thin and light and resembles the finest French china. Every piece is artistically embossed with a beautiful scroll, which forms a complete border. All plates, saucers, platters, etc., have scalloped festoon edges and are branded on the back by the famous makers' trade mark.
As the advert above mentioned, Colonial is a round, scallop shape with light scroll work embossing. The hollowware is easily identified by its segmented handles. Finials on the lidded pieces tend to resemble sea horses' heads.
